One in five Australians went hungry over past year, study finds
Foodbank Hunger report says 21% of people ran out of food and were unable to buy more, up from 18% in 2018. One in five Australians went hungry once over the past year, according to a new survey that also finds demand for food bank services has increased by more than 20% across Australia in 12 months.
